Using Your Wood Stove Efficiently and Effectively - Penn State Extension

WebOct 28, 2013 · Properly dried and seasoned wood, at about 20 percent moisture by weight, has about 12 percent more available energy in it than if you use it when it is freshly cut at 45 percent moisture. On top of that, residential wood stoves tend to burn more efficiently when using dry wood. If at all possible, keep your wood well stacked and under cover in ... WebApr 9, 2024 · The answer is yes, you can leave a wood burning stove on overnight as long as you follow some simple safety guidelines. First, make sure that the flue is open so that any fumes can escape. Second, keep a fire extinguisher close by in case of an emergency. Third, check the stove regularly to make sure that the fire is not getting out of control.
